If you searched “mA to A,” you probably want the answer fast. Here it is: 1,000 mA = 1 A. To convert milliamps to amps, divide by 1,000. But the useful next step is understanding what that current means in real-world watts, device compatibility, and portable power station sizing.
Direct answer
mA to A formula: A = mA ÷ 1,000Examples:
500 mA = 0.5 A
1,200 mA = 1.2 A
2,000 mA = 2 A
5,000 mA = 5 A
What mA and A measure
Both are units of electric current. They do not tell runtime by themselves.

Quick mA to A conversion table
| Milliamps (mA) | Amps (A) | Practical context |
|---|---|---|
| 100 mA | 0.1 A | Very small electronics or indicator circuits |
| 500 mA | 0.5 A | Small USB accessories |
| 1,000 mA | 1 A | Basic low-draw charging |
| 1,200 mA | 1.2 A | Routers or light DC equipment |
| 2,000 mA | 2 A | Common charger range |
| 3,000 mA | 3 A | Higher-output USB-C devices |
| 5,000 mA | 5 A | Heavier 5V or 12V accessory loads |
| 10,000 mA | 10 A | Higher-current DC systems |
From amps to watts to portable power station sizing
After converting mA to A, the next important formula is:
Examples:
5V × 2A = 10W
12V × 5A = 60W
24V × 3A = 72W
Once you know the watts, you can start choosing the right power station with enough output headroom and enough watt-hours for runtime.
